Output 0c51a29d8d79c62b3a31501af1f8c4670877e068d066170cb77b6da9bc77f712:1

value
319600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 852fac2b8ff27d4e9387ce17e3c5f9903189ada7 OP_EQUAL
address
3DqEuQM3m75RyJWZVNWeUbQUyF4Q8jpC2r
transaction
0c51a29d8d79c62b3a31501af1f8c4670877e068d066170cb77b6da9bc77f712
confirmations
267599
spent
true